Replying to un-starred question of Dr Nishikant Dubey, Shri Rajkumar Roat, the Union Minister of State for Tribal Affairs Shri Durgadas Uikey informed Lok Sabha today that the details of the total number of tribals in the country including Jharkhand, State-wise as per census 2011, is given in Annexure 1.
For Post Matric Scholarship and Pre Matric Scholarship no. of beneficiaries is 1988462 and 944000 for 2023-24 respectively. For National Overseas Scholarship for ST students and National Fellowship for ST students no of beneficiaries is 65 and 2975 respectively for 2023-24. For Scholarship for Higher Education (Top Class Education) no of beneficiaries is 5429 for 2023-24. For Grants in aid for voluntary Organisations, number of beneficiaries are 730461 for 2024-25.
As per PMAG-Y portal, the total no of beneficiaries in Awas Yojana under DAPST is presently 6288872 completed houses for scheduled tribe community.
For Ekalavya Model Residential School (EMRS), as on date, 728 schools have been approved, out of which 479 EMRSs have been reported to be functional across the country benefiting about 1,38,336 ST students including 70,137 girl students.

(e) The Central Government does not allocate the central tribal budget directly to State Tribal Advisory Committees and District Tribal Councils for expenditure at their level.

- Government is implementing Development Action Plan for Scheduled Tribes (DAPST) as a strategy for the development of Scheduled Tribes and areas having tribal concentration. 41 Ministries/Departments are allocating certain percentage of their total scheme budget every year for tribal development under DAPST for various tribal development projects relating to education, health, agriculture, irrigation, roads, housing, electrification, employment generation, skill development, etc. Ministry of Tribal Affairs is implementing various schemes/programmes for the welfare and development of the of the Scheduled Tribes (STs) in the country.
